Let

x -----> the thing you are in control

y -----> the result of that thing

we ahve the ordered pairs

(3,40) and (6,61)

I will assume that is a linear relationship between x and y

so

Step 1

Find the slope or unit rate

the formula to calculate the slope between two points is equal to

m=(y2-y1)/(x2-x1)

we have

(x1,y1)=(3,40)

(x2,y2)=(6,61)

substitute in the formula

m=(61-40)/(6-3)

m=21/3

m=7

step 2

Find the equation of the linear equation

we know that'the equation of a line in point slope form is equal to

y-y1=m(x-x1)

we have

m=7

(x1,y1)=(3,40)

substitute

y-40=7(x-3)

y-40=7x-21

y=7x-21+40

y=7x+19

Remember that

the variable x is the input

the variable y is the output

so

The question is what’s the output of 72

so

For x=72

substitute in the equation

y=7(72)+19

y=523

The output is 523
